The Smart Buyer's Checklist
Choosing a 24V power inverter isn't about finding the "best" - it's about finding your perfect match. Ask yourself:
- Do I need pure sine wave for sensitive medical equipment?
- Will parallel connectivity support future expansion?
- How does the IP rating suit my environment? (Hint: IP65 rules marine applications)

FAQ: Your 24V Inverter Questions Answered
Q: Can I connect multiple batteries to a 24V inverter? A: Absolutely! Most models support parallel battery connections - just maintain voltage consistency.
Q: How long will a 24V system power my refrigerator? A: Depends on battery capacity. A 200Ah battery bank typically runs a mid-size fridge for 18-24 hours.
